Transaction

4c77d5de46b7ca874fef8eaba0fe9651c60bafda0b942937336debc4d23c2c13

Summary

In Block768670
TimeThu, 04 Jul 2024 12:30:15 UTC
Total Input556.7702118 Nebula
Total Output577.7702118 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
197200 Confirmations577.7702118 Nebula
Raw Transaction